Sustainability Takes Centre Stage
Sustainability remains a key focus for consumers and designers alike. More brands are prioritising eco-friendly materials and responsible sourcing in their dining furniture lines. Expect to see a rise in tables and chairs made from reclaimed wood, bamboo, and recycled metals. This not only supports the environment but also creates unique pieces with interesting character. As consumers lean towards sustainable options, dining spaces will reflect this commitment to a greener future.
Bold Colours and Patterns
Say goodbye to subdued neutrals! 2025 brings an influx of bold colours and patterns into modern dining rooms. Deep jewel tones like emerald green, royal blue, and rich burgundy are becoming popular choices for upholstery, while striking prints on dining chairs will make a statement. Consider pairing a vibrant tablecloth or runner with matching or complementary dish ware to enhance your dining experience and create an eye-catching centrepiece.
Multi-Functional Furniture
With homes becoming more multifunctional, dining furniture is evolving to meet diverse needs. Expect to see innovative designs that combine dining areas with workspaces, providing flexible solutions for those who work from home. Extendable dining tables, modular seating, and storage-integrated pieces will help create versatile spaces that adapt to various functions, from family dinners to entertaining guests.
Curves and Organic Shapes
Straight lines are making way for softer, more organic shapes in dining furniture design. Rounded tables and chairs not only create a more inviting atmosphere but also encourage conversation and connection. Curvilinear designs are not only aesthetically pleasing but also add a contemporary touch to dining spaces. Pairing these rounded pieces with angular accessories can create a dynamic balance that's visually interesting and modern.
Mixed Materials
Mixing different materials is a trend that continues to gain momentum in 2025. Combining wood, metal, glass, and textiles can create striking contrast and elevate your dining area’s design. For instance, a wooden dining table with sleek metal legs or glass tabletops paired with upholstered seating can create a harmonious yet eclectic look. This trend allows for personalisation and creativity, as homeowners can mix and match materials to fit their unique styles.
Minimalist Aesthetics
The minimalist trend remains strong, emphasising simplicity and functionality. This year, look for dining furniture with clean lines and understated designs that blend seamlessly into any space. Neutral colour palettes, open silhouettes, and uncluttered surfaces are characteristics of this trend. Minimalism doesn’t mean sacrificing style, rather, it focuses on quality pieces that are both beautiful and practical.
